Oct 13, 2008 - No, that was 1987. A tire came of Tony Bettenhausen's car and Roberto Guerrero struck it at speed. Unfortunately, the tire just failed to clear an uncovered grandstand in turn 3 and fatally struck Lyle Kurtenback in the top row.
